# Orbital Infrastructure Group files Chapter 11; seeks to sell two profitable subsidiaries for debt repayment

## Summary
- Filed Chapter 11 on Aug 23, 2023; subsidiaries FLP and GTS excluded and to be sold via stalking horse bids.
- Intends to sell equity interests in FLP and GTS to respective secured lenders as stalking horse bidders under Section 363.
- Received commitment for $15.0M in debtor-in-possession (DIP) financing from FLP and GTS lenders to fund operations.
- Chapter 11 filing triggers acceleration of ~$306M in debt obligations; Nasdaq delisting expected without appeal.
- Company cites strategic alternatives process; aims to preserve profitable parts as going concerns through sale.

## Key facts
- Debt Financings
  Orbital Infrastructure Group, Inc. faced acceleration on loan of original principal amount of approximately $33.9 million with Kurt A. Johnson.
  - Instrument: loan
  - Principal: original principal amount of approximately $33.9 million
  - Counterparty: Kurt A. Johnson
  - Event: acceleration
  source text: ● Amended and Restated Secured Promissory Note (“Johnson Note”), dated May 26, 2023, issued by the Company in favor of Kurt A. Johnson (“Johnson”), in an original principal amount of approximately $33.9 million.

- Debt Financings
  Orbital Infrastructure Group, Inc. faced acceleration on term loan of original principal amount of $105.0 million with Alter Domus (US) LLC.
  - Instrument: term loan
  - Principal: original principal amount of $105.0 million
  - Counterparty: Alter Domus (US) LLC
  - Event: acceleration
  source text: The filing of the Chapter 11 Cases constitutes an event of default that accelerated the Company Parties’ obligations under the following debt instruments (the “Debt Instruments”): ● Term Loan pursuant to that certain Credit Agreement, dated as of November 17, 2021, by and among Front Line, as borrower, the Company, as parent, and certain subsidiaries, as guarantors, and Alter Domus (US) LLC, as administrative agent and collateral agent, and the various lenders from time to time party thereto, in an original principal amount of $105.0 million.

- Distress & Bankruptcy
  Orbital Infrastructure Group, Inc. entered chapter 11 in U.S. Bankruptcy Court for the Southern District of Texas, Houston Division (petition 2023-08-23).
  - Proceeding: chapter 11
  - Court: U.S. Bankruptcy Court for the Southern District of Texas, Houston Division
  - Petition: 2023-08-23
  source text: On August 23, 2023 (the “Petition Date”), Orbital Infrastructure Group, Inc. (the “Company”) and certain of its subsidiaries (collectively, the “Company Parties”) filed voluntary petitions (the “Chapter 11 Cases”) under Chapter 11 of the Bankruptcy Code in the U.S. Bankruptcy Court for the Southern District of Texas, Houston Division (the “Bankruptcy Court”).
